Leeds United squad poses for group photo at team meal – two defenders are missing

Leeds United players have been pictured out on a team bonding exercise this week, ahead of Sunday’s visit to Norwich City in the first leg of their Championship play-off semi-final.

But in the photo that has been posted on X [9 May], it has been noticed that two of the squad are missing.

Connor Roberts and Charlie Cresswell are two notable Leeds players absent from the picture, as supporters debate their whereabouts.

Roberts will return to parent club Burnley at the end of Leeds’ campaign, whilst Cresswell – under contract until 2027 – has only made five league appearances all season after spending last term on a successful loan spell with Millwall.

It was reported recently that Cresswell had fallen out with manager Daniel Farke over limited game time.

Who will stay and who will leave Leeds?

With Roberts expected to head back to Burnley – especially with the Clarets’ likely relegation from the Premier League – there appears to be no future concern regarding him.

The defender passed a late fitness test before last weekend’s defeat to Southampton but only played 13 minutes.

As for Cresswell, it’s becoming increasingly likely that the Thorp Arch academy product will move on in the summer, especially should Farke remain at the helm next season.

The England Under-21 man was linked with a permanent move to Millwall in January following his loan spell last year, and will gauge plenty of interest from various clubs as to his precarious position at Elland Road.

A reshuffle will be considered over the summer – profiles of player depending on the division Leeds will be in – but there could also be a move away for Marc Roca, and key performer Crysencio Summerville has unsurprisingly attracted Premier League interest.
